Understanding the K20C1 Engine
The K20C1 engine is a turbocharged inline-four engine developed by Honda. It is known for its lightweight design and high-revving capabilities. Here are some key features of the K20C1 engine:
- Displacement: 2.0 liters
- Power Output: 306 hp (factory)
- Torque: 295 lb-ft (factory)
- Turbocharged: Yes
- Direct Injection: Yes

Achieving 550+ HP: Key Modifications
To achieve over 550 horsepower from the K20C1 engine with the GTX3076 turbo, several modifications are necessary. These modifications enhance airflow, fuel delivery, and engine management. Here are the essential upgrades:
- Upgraded fuel injectors (1000cc or larger)
- High-performance fuel pump
- Aftermarket intercooler for better cooling
- Custom exhaust manifold to reduce backpressure
- Upgraded engine management system (ECU tuning)
Custom Tuning: The Heart of Performance
Custom tuning is crucial for optimizing the K20C1’s performance with the GTX3076 turbo. Proper tuning ensures that the engine runs efficiently and reliably at higher power levels. Here are the steps involved in custom tuning:
- Baseline dyno run to establish current power levels
- Adjust fuel maps to accommodate increased airflow
- Tweak ignition timing for optimal performance
- Monitor air-fuel ratios to prevent lean conditions
- Conduct multiple dyno runs to refine settings
